How do I remove calcium deposits from my Pool Tile?

Calcium deposits usually originate from grout or setting mortar. To remove, scrape it off the tile. Another method for removing calcium deposits is the pumice stone. Pumice is a light porous glassy lava stone, that can be rubbed over a pool stain to remove it.

You can get a pumice stone that can attach to your telescopic pole, or a pumice stone that has a handle you can swim with.
